This week’s recipe is for real coffee lovers. I made a rich and not too sweet coffee ice cream with fresh coffee beans from my favorite local roaster, Applied Arts Coffee. You can use any coffee beans you have available. Served with the chocolate espresso bean cookies, this has a double coffee (and caffeine) punch. The coffee ice cream would also be delicious in profiteroles or alongside my old fashioned chocolate cake.
If you like a chunky ice cream you can chop the cookies and fold them into the ice cream when it comes out of the ice cream maker.
